1570nm High Power PM Bandpass Filter/Isolator Hybrid

DESCRIPTION
Haphit provides fiber based passive components. The Bandpass Filter/Isolator Hybrid is made by thin film coating and micro-optics package technology with Polarization Maintaining (PM) fiber in and PM fiber out. It features flat-top spectrum, high Suppression Ratio, high Extinction Ratio and high Isolation. The Bandpass Filter/Isolator Hybrid will pass the signal light while block both the unwanted/ASE light and backward signal. The high power version can withstand up to 20W CW Power while maintaining high performance and stability. Y Type or X type is strongly recommended to guide out high power ASE/unwanted light out. Customer can select only slow axis working or both axis working option. Various pass bandwidth and fiber types are available, customized on bandwidth and consigned fiber type are also available on request.

TYPICAL SPECIFICATIONS
Center Wavelength 1570nm
Min. Bandwidth@0.5dB 4nm 9nm 15nm
Configuration D Type (2-port), Y Type (3-port), X Type (4-port)
Signal Isolation >=25dB (Single Stage) >=40dB (Dual Stage) >=20dB (H Stage)
Insertion Loss <=1.3dB (Single Stage) <=1.5dB (Dual Stage) <=1.8dB (H Stage)
Wavelength Supression >=25dB
Return Loss >=45dB
Extinction Ratio >=18dB
Fiber Type PM1550 Fiber or 10/130um PMDC Fiber
12/130um PMDC Fiber or 20/130um PMDC Fiber
25/250um PMDC Fiber or 25/300um PMDC Fiber
Max. Optical Power (CW) 1W, 2W, 3W, 5W, 10W, 15W, 20W
Operating Temperature 0~70degreeC
